Revert "brcmfmac: send mailbox interrupt twice for specific hardware device"
authorKalle Valo <kvalo@codeaurora.org>
Thu, 25 Apr 2019 17:08:31 +0000 (20:08 +0300)
committerKalle Valo <kvalo@codeaurora.org>
Thu, 25 Apr 2019 17:08:31 +0000 (20:08 +0300)
This reverts commit 99d94ef367af67f630b38c93ff46c5819b7d06b6. I accidentally
applied this broken (failed to compile) patch due to a bug in my patchwork
script.

Signed-off-by: Kalle Valo <kvalo@codeaurora.org>
drivers/net/wireless/broadcom/brcm80211/brcmfmac/pcie.c

index 66ee92bb51789cb1cc57391e21d72c7a4d55136d..fd3968fd158e95e6bcc55fb6884b4d26e138f2d2 100644 (file)
@@ -698,11 +698,7 @@ brcmf_pcie_send_mb_data(struct brcmf_pciedev_info *devinfo, u32 htod_mb_data)
 
        brcmf_pcie_write_tcm32(devinfo, addr, htod_mb_data);
        pci_write_config_dword(devinfo->pdev, BRCMF_PCIE_REG_SBMBX, 1);
-
-       /* Send mailbox interrupt twice as a hardware workaround */
-       core = brcmf_chip_get_core(devinfo->ci, BCMA_CORE_PCIE2);
-       if (core->rev <= 13)
-               pci_write_config_dword(devinfo->pdev, BRCMF_PCIE_REG_SBMBX, 1);
+       pci_write_config_dword(devinfo->pdev, BRCMF_PCIE_REG_SBMBX, 1);
 
        return 0;
 }